I have an extremely fast clock running this command:
execute @e[type=WitherSkull] ~ ~ ~ particle happyVillager ~ ~1 ~ 0.3 4 0.3 0 5
It runs fine until a few minutes later when the game starts to lag (it is not framerate lag it closely resembles server lag) then upon reloading the world, the game crashes (crash log attached). After the crash the world loads fine.
UPDATE (14w30c) : A few snapshots back they resolved this crash. Although the game no longer crashes after a while of game-play on the world, which is full of running redstone, there is still the same odd lag that was present before. To resolve it you have to exit the game and restart it. I Have no clue what causes it as there are many things running. I will attach the world for further testing!
